Mok在线HTTP请求模拟器:快速模拟与自定义响应

需积分: 10 0 下载量 144 浏览量 更新于2024-12-31 收藏 3KB ZIP 举报
资源摘要信息:"mok是一个简易的在线HTTP请求模拟工具,主要通过提供一个特定的URL后端服务来模拟真实的HTTP请求。用户可以通过该服务快速地生成预设的HTTP响应,以便于在开发过程中测试前端应用或API。 1. 标题知识点: - "mok": 表示这个在线服务的名称。 - "简单的在线HTTP请求模拟解决方案": 暗示该服务提供了一个轻量级的模拟环境,方便用户快速搭建和测试HTTP请求的模拟。 2. 描述知识点: - 基本网址:https://mok.now.sh/,是访问该服务的主地址,用户通过这个URL进行所有模拟请求的交互。 - 请求示例:展示了使用wget命令行工具发送请求到mok服务的基本格式,其中 "$@" 是一个特殊的shell变量,这里用作示例,实际中应该替换为具体的选项。该请求返回的是一个JSON格式的响应体。 - 路径:指的是在mok服务中,可以指定不同的路径,模拟不同的请求,但响应内容并不依赖于这个路径。 - 选项:用户可以通过在基本URL后附加参数的形式来影响服务器的响应。例如,添加选项参数 key=value,可以根据不同的需求定制化响应。 - 等待:这部分描述了一个名为"wait"的选项,用户可以通过设置该选项的值(以毫秒为单位),来模拟网络延迟的情况。 3. 标签知识点: - "JavaScript": 暗示mok服务后端可能使用JavaScript语言开发,或者mok服务提供的接口可能支持JavaScript调用。 4. 压缩包子文件的文件名称列表知识点: - "mok-master": 表明了与该服务相关的文件或代码存储在名为"mok-master"的文件夹中,通常这样的命名风格用于表示源代码的根目录或主分支。 从这些信息中,我们可以了解到mok服务的设计目的和使用方法。mok通过提供一个简单的在线服务,使开发者能够方便地模拟各种HTTP请求和响应。这样,开发者就不需要在没有后端服务的情况下进行前端的测试,能够显著提高开发效率和降低环境配置的复杂度。 使用该服务时,用户需要构造特定格式的URL,包含所需模拟的路径和选项参数。例如,如果需要模拟一个JSON响应,可以像描述中提供的示例那样,构造相应的请求URL。选项可以用于调整响应内容、状态码、内容类型等。"wait"选项则是模拟网络延迟,对于测试网络请求的异步处理特别有用。 总的来说,mok是一个为开发人员提供的快速而简单的在线HTTP请求模拟工具,适合于开发阶段的API测试和前端验证。它不需要复杂的配置,通过简单的URL修改即可实现多种模拟场景,极大地提升了开发过程中的便捷性。"